8“Intersection”
The names of two intersecting streets can
be entered.  This is helpful if only the gen-
eral vicinity, not the specific address, is
known. 57 . . . . . . . .

Turn the knob clockwise to step up the
station band or counterclockwise to
step down.
Your radio automatically changes to stereo
reception when a stereo broadcast is re-
ceived.
